Washington is justly proud of its school, it is a mixed sex Primary for age range 5-10 years and there are approximately 90 pupils to date. The school had its OFSTED inspection in June 2007 with exceptional results, ganing grade 1 in all areas. The report stated: “This is an outstanding school because standards are high at the end of key stage 1 and by the time the pupils leave the school at the end of year 5. Pupils make excellent progress during their time at the school.” It is recorded that there was a schoolmaster in Washington in 1579, but apparently ‘no fit pupils’! St. Mary’s C.E.
